Course Overview

The Honours Bachelor of Public Relations from the University of Ottawa is designed for ambitious individuals seeking to master the strategic communication skills essential in today's interconnected world. You will explore the dynamic field of public relations, understanding its critical role in shaping organizational reputation, managing public perception, and fostering stakeholder relationships across diverse sectors like business, government, and non-profits. This program equips you with foundational knowledge in communication, media studies, and public relations, preparing you for impactful careers where clear, ethical, and strategic messaging is paramount.

This comprehensive undergraduate degree is studied full-time on campus over four years, blending core courses in areas such as communication planning, crisis communication, and media ethics with opportunities for specialization through optional electives. You will engage with research methods and gain practical insights into organizational communication and public opinion. The curriculum is structured to build your expertise progressively, culminating in advanced seminars. Upon graduation, you will be prepared to pursue roles in public relations, corporate communications, and strategic messaging, equipped with the analytical and practical skills demanded by leading organizations.

Program Overview

This program provides a comprehensive education in public relations, covering foundational communication principles and advanced strategic practices. Students will explore organizational and media studies, research methodologies, and specialized areas such as crisis communication and new media. The curriculum also offers opportunities to delve into elective topics like advertising, political communication, and audience research, allowing for tailored learning experiences within the broader field of public relations.

1 Core Courses (60 Units)

Introduction to Organizational Communication Compulsory
Introduction to Media Studies Compulsory
Workshop in Essay Writing Compulsory
Research Methods in Communication Compulsory
Interpersonal Communication Compulsory
Organizational Communication Compulsory
Theories of the Media Compulsory
New Media Compulsory
Quantitative Methods Compulsory
Qualitative Methods Compulsory
Media Ethics Compulsory
Communication Planning Compulsory
Public Relations Compulsory
Crisis Communication Compulsory
Advanced Public Relations Seminar Compulsory

Can I work while studying?

International students can work up to 24 hours per week off-campus during term time and unlimited hours during breaks. No separate work permit is needed for on-campus employment.

What English language score do I need for this course?

Applicants must meet specific English test requirements, such as a minimum overall score of 86 on the TOEFL or 6.5 on the IELTS. Other accepted tests include Duolingo and PTE with their respective minimum scores.

What jobs can I get after studying this course?

Graduates can pursue careers as Public Relations Specialists, Event Coordinators, Communication Managers, Marketing Consultants, and Crisis Managers.
